Clements Centre Society is seeking a Casual On-Call Community Inclusion Worker specializing in bakery activities. Support individuals with disabilities in a vibrant social enterprise.
As part of the Mindful Mouthful initiative, your role will focus on facilitating bakery participation for diverse individuals. You will leverage your interpersonal and advocacy skills to provide guidance and support in community living settings. Your ability to engage effectively will help create a nurturing setting for participants and families alike.
Key Responsibilities:
• Facilitate bakery-related engagement for individuals
• Advocate for community support and personalized assistance
• Teach participants essential life skills
• Collaborate with families,
volunteers, and organizational staff
• Execute time management efficiently while working independently
Requirements:
• Community Support Worker Certificate or similar experience
• Minimum three months’ related experience with disabilities
• Valid First Aid and CPR certifications
• Food Safety Certification required
• Driver's license and positive criminal check needed
